Like you, I also own a Nokia phone that runs on the Symbian S40 OS and IMHO, the Tequila Cat Book Reader ( http://handheld.softpedia.com/get/Documents-E-Books/TequilaCat-BookReader-27559.shtml , http://tequilacat.org/dev/br/index-en.html ) is an indispensable tool for doing exactly what you’ve asked in your question.
It is very simple, absolutely straight-forward, detailed and produces excellent results. Best of all – It’s FREE!
It is a lot easier than MJBook (arguably the most-popular, but fairly complicated e-book builder for JAR applets). Also, it has a step-by-step interface that renders creating e-books all the more easier.
How I make e-books for mobile-reading using Tequila Cat:
1. Copy all of the text from a PDF into a simple text file and save it somewhere.
2. Open Tequila Cat’s shell executable and choose my phone’s platform (i.e. Nokia > S40)
3. Configure the e-book by adding the text file and follow Tequila Cat’s process sequentially.
4. Make all suitable changes for getting handsome results - like the font type, color and size. I like a black background with grayish font color and medium (10) font size. Also, I like setting the background intensity at 50%.
5. Finally, click Install Created Books and click the Big-Square-Button on the bottom to build my very own JAR e-books!
